Section II Part D Table 1A Note G12

Section II Part D Table 1A Note G12

Section II Part D Table 1A Note G12

(OP)
SA-240 Gr. 316 Max. Temperature Limit for Sect VIII Div. 1 is 1500 F. Note G12: above 1000 F these stress values apply only when the carbon content is 0.04% or greater. I take this to mean you can't use this material above 1000 F if the carbon content is less than 0.04% carbon, because you have no stress value to use. Thoughts on this?

RE: Section II Part D Table 1A Note G12

Correct in your interpretation.
